Output 84f96cae325ea54eec3f2924493925896cfcd9638ebb03a542a5cf900bd2d355:14

value
20005480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3d851e1bd935e40c5f864cac34ac90dc462d5ad OP_EQUALVERIFY OP_CHECKSIG
address
Ld5VAnad6gL9DkVL9VskTRw4NrNgZ1UWWU
transaction
84f96cae325ea54eec3f2924493925896cfcd9638ebb03a542a5cf900bd2d355
spent
true